Thanks, Ross. Actually, we are doing exactly that already -- it's how we 
noticed the timestamp issue in the first place. However, that doesn't fix it 
when we have multiple logged events that we want to calculate time deltas 
between, such as:

2011-02-15T10:11:12.123 Starting request
2011-02-15T10:11:12.123 Doing stuff
2011-02-15T10:11:12.123 Filtering stuff
2011-02-15T10:11:12.123 Rendering template
2011-02-15T10:11:12.123 Request complete, took 0.56 ms

It seems to me that the logging module should use a millisecond-accurate 
timestamp (time.clock) on Windows, just like the "timeit" module does.
